Absolute Maximum Ratings
These are stress ratings only and functional operation is not implied. Exposure to absolute
maximum ratings for prolonged time periods may affect device reliability. All voltages are with
respect to ground.
Supply Voltage ............................................6.6V
Input Voltage.............................-0.3V to V + DD 0.3V
Maximum Junction Temperature..................150°C
Storage Temperature.....................-65°C to 150°C
Soldering Temperature......................300°C, 5sec
Recommended Operating Conditions
Supply Voltage Range.......................2.8V to 5.5V
Max. Supply Voltage (for Max. duration of
30 minutes)................................................6.4V
Junction Temperature Range.........-40°C to 125°C
Ambient Temperature Range............-40°C to 85°C
